     Your Committee on Finance, to which was referred H.B. No. 227, H.D. 2, entitled:

 

"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O HEALTH,"

 

begs leave to report as follows:

 

     The purpose of this measure is to bolster the Department of Health's enforcement activities to protect the health, safety, and welfare of the State's elderly and vulnerable populations by:

 

     (1)  Clarifying the group of professionals who are prohibited from knowingly referring or transferring patients to an uncertified or unlicensed care facility;

 

     (2)  Repealing the provision that a landlord, under specified conditions, shall not be deemed to be providing home care services or operating a care facility that requires a license; and

 

     (3)  Requiring the Department of Health to prioritize complaint allegations based on severity for investigations of state-licensed or state-certified care facilities.

 

     Your Committee received testimony in support of this measure from the Department of Health, Executive Office on Aging, Big Island Adult Foster Home Operators, United Caregivers of Hawaii, Adult Foster Homecare Association of Hawaii, Okano Care Home, and ten individuals.  Your Committee received testimony in opposition to this measure from the Hawaii Primary Care Association.  Your Committee received comments on this measure from the Department of Human Services.

 

     As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your Committee on Finance that is attached to this report, your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of H.B. No. 227, H.D. 2, and recommends that it pass Third Reading.
